链接不了数据库是什么原因
-
链接不了数据库可能有以下几个原因:
-
数据库服务未启动:数据库服务可能没有正确启动,导致无法连接数据库。需要检查数据库服务是否已经启动,并确保服务正常运行。
-
数据库连接配置错误:数据库连接需要正确配置,包括数据库地址、端口号、用户名和密码等信息。如果配置错误,就无法连接数据库。需要检查连接配置,确保连接参数正确。
-
防火墙或安全组设置:防火墙或安全组设置可能会阻止数据库连接。需要检查防火墙或安全组设置,确保允许数据库连接的流量通过。
-
数据库权限问题:数据库用户可能没有足够的权限连接数据库。需要检查数据库用户的权限设置,确保用户具有连接数据库的权限。
-
网络问题:网络连接问题也可能导致无法连接数据库。需要检查网络连接是否正常,包括网络配置、网络延迟等方面。
以上是一些常见的导致无法连接数据库的原因,根据具体情况进行排查和解决。可以逐一检查以上几点,并根据错误提示信息进行进一步的调试和排查。
1年前 -
-
链接不上数据库的原因可能有多种,下面我将列举一些常见的原因和解决方法。
-
数据库服务器未启动:首先,检查数据库服务器是否已经启动。可以通过查看数据库服务器的状态或者尝试连接其他数据库来确认。
-
数据库服务器端口号设置错误:数据库服务器通常会监听一个特定的端口号,用于接收客户端的连接请求。确认数据库服务器的端口号是否正确,并且客户端连接时使用的端口号是否与服务器配置一致。
-
防火墙阻止了数据库连接:防火墙可能会阻止对数据库服务器的访问。检查防火墙设置,确保允许客户端和服务器之间的通信。
-
数据库用户名或密码错误:确认连接数据库时使用的用户名和密码是否正确。如果忘记了密码,可以尝试重新设置密码或者使用其他具有访问权限的用户账号。
-
数据库服务器拒绝了连接:数据库服务器可能会配置连接限制,例如限制最大连接数或者限制特定IP地址的访问。检查数据库服务器的配置,确保允许客户端的连接。
-
数据库名称错误:连接数据库时需要指定要连接的数据库名称。确认数据库名称是否正确。
-
客户端库版本不兼容:如果客户端使用的数据库库版本与服务器版本不兼容,可能会导致连接失败。尝试更新客户端库或者使用与服务器版本兼容的客户端库。
-
网络连接问题:检查网络连接是否正常,确认客户端与数据库服务器之间的网络是否通畅。
-
其他问题:如果以上步骤都没有解决问题,可能是其他原因导致的连接失败,例如数据库服务器配置错误、网络故障等。可以查看数据库服务器的日志文件,查找更详细的错误信息。
总之,连接不上数据库的原因有很多可能性,需要逐一排查。根据具体情况,可以参考以上常见原因和解决方法,逐步排查并解决问题。
1年前 -
-
链接不了数据库的原因可能有多种,以下是一些常见的原因和解决方法:
-
数据库服务未启动:首先确保数据库服务已经启动。可以通过检查数据库服务状态或者尝试重启数据库服务来解决。不同的数据库服务有不同的启动方式,可以参考数据库的文档或者官方网站来了解具体的操作方法。
-
连接配置错误:检查连接数据库的配置信息是否正确。包括数据库的地址、端口号、用户名和密码等。可以尝试使用其他数据库管理工具来验证连接配置的正确性。
-
防火墙或网络问题:防火墙或网络设置可能会阻止数据库连接。确保数据库的端口号在防火墙或网络设置中是开放的。可以尝试关闭防火墙或者修改网络设置来解决。
-
数据库权限问题:如果连接数据库的用户没有足够的权限,那么连接就会失败。确保连接数据库的用户具有足够的权限,包括访问数据库的权限和执行相关操作的权限。
-
数据库连接池问题:如果使用数据库连接池来管理数据库连接,那么连接池的配置可能会影响连接数据库的成功与否。可以检查连接池的配置信息,包括最大连接数、空闲连接超时时间等。
-
数据库版本不兼容:如果使用的数据库客户端或驱动程序与数据库的版本不兼容,那么连接就会失败。确保使用的数据库客户端或驱动程序与数据库的版本匹配。
-
数据库故障:如果数据库发生故障,比如磁盘空间满、数据库损坏等,那么连接就会失败。可以通过检查数据库的日志或者尝试重启数据库来解决。
-
其他问题:还有一些其他的问题可能导致连接不了数据库,比如数据库连接超时、数据库连接数达到上限等。可以通过查看数据库的日志或者尝试调整相关的配置来解决。
总之,连接不了数据库的原因可能有很多,需要逐个排查并解决。可以根据具体的情况进行相应的操作和调整。如果仍然无法解决,可以参考数据库的文档或者咨询相关的专业人士。
1年前 -